Two elite quarterbacks and brothers as head coaches lead the Monday Night Football feature on Nov. 25 when the Baltimore Ravens (7-4) tackle the Los Angeles Chargers (7-3) at SoFi Stadium.
The Ravens-Chargers matchup is the only one in Week 12 between teams with winning records.

Lamar Jackson and Justin Herbert will be most popular player props to attack in the featured Monday Night Football matchup. Let's fire on Herbert over 258.5 passing yards. He's passing at an elite rate since Week 7 as his early-season ankle injury has healed.
- BAL QB Lamar Jackson passing yards: Over/Under 235.5, rushing 43.5
- LAC QB Justin Herbert passing yards: O/U 258.5, rushing 20.5
The Ravens defense ranks No. 28 in opponent dropback EPA while allowing a league worst 284 passing yards per game. Herbert has passed for at least 279 yards in four of his last five games as the team and OC Greg Roman has balanced the attack more with their healthier, gifted passer. Recall Roman was the Ravens offensive coordinator prior to taking the Chargers OC position, and he's very familiar with the Ravens' personnel and defensive schemes.
